Before you go off and find a fence and have it installed, you need to think about others before doing it.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. The last thing you want is hassle either from your neighbors or the local office for zoning compliance. The thing about this is you are unfortunately not able to put something you want on your property because you want it - you need various permissions sometimes.
In the even that something goes wrong later on, you want the contractor to fix it - but that will depend on the warranty. Just like all other transactions, the best peace of mind you can have is if you can see it in documentation. On the other hand, it is ultimately the business you buy it from that has to implement the warranty, and that is an area that could potentially harbor some difficulties. You can get in trouble sometimes with buying fences from a large chain store because they can contract it out to anybody.
